The Eastern Michigan gymnastics team placed third at the Mid-American Championships on Saturday in DeKalb, Illinois. The team finished with a 195.350 score, behind Northern Illinois (195.975) and Central Michigan (195.575). The Eagles fell 0.625 points short of winning their fourth conference championship.

Eastern Michigan held their 2019 Pro Day on March 22 in their indoor practice facility, showcasing their 12 draft-eligible players in front of pro scouts. Over a dozen teams from the National Football League (NFL) and Canadian Football League (CFL) were in attendance for the Pro Day, including the Detroit Lions, New England Patriots, Atlanta Falcons and Saskatchewan Roughriders.

Eastern Michigan Baseball opened Mid-American Conference play with a three-game series sweep versus rival Northern Illinois on March 22-24 at Ralph McKinzie Stadium in Dekalb, Ill. This marks the fifth time that the Eagles have been swept this season, leaving them with a MAC worst record of 3-19-1. The Huskies on the other hand now have a slightly better record of 7-16.

The Buffalo Women’s Basketball team has won the Mid-American Conference Tournament championship, taking down Ohio in the championship game Saturday, March 16 at Quicken Loans Arena in Cleveland, Ohio. The Bulls will advance to the NCAA Tournament for the third time in school history, after reaching the Sweet Sixteen last season.

Eastern Michigan senior forward Danielle Minott earned honorable mention All-MAC honors, alongside Oshlynn Brown (Ball State), Kendall McCoy (Miami OH), Mikaela Boyd (Toledo) and Deja Wimby (Western Michigan). Minott averaged 13.6 points and 5.7 rebounds per game in her senior season.

Going into its eighth season under head coach, Rob Murphy, the Eastern Michigan Men’s Basketball team had high optimism for the 2018-19 season. However, the Eagles finished the season with a 15-17 overall record. The team finished third in the MAC West with a 9-9 conference record.

Eastern Michigan Baseball was swept in a four-game series against Marshall in Huntington, W. Va. at the Kennedy Center on March 9-10. The series consisted of two doubleheaders, something that the Eagles have struggled with all season. They have not won a double header game yet, losing all nine this year.

Danielle Minott scored the winning layup for Eastern Michigan with 2.6 seconds left in the fourth quarter, leading to a 61-59 victory over Akron at James A. Rhodes Arena on Monday, March 11. The Eagles move on to the quarterfinals round of the MAC Tournament to play Central Michigan in Cleveland on March 13 at noon.
